What Are Non-UK Licensed Casinos?

Non-UK licensed casinos operate outside the jurisdiction of the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C). They are licensed and regulated by authorities in other countries, such as Malta, Curacao, or Gibraltar, among others. While these casinos may promise exciting gaming experiences, players need to be aware of the legal and safety implications associated with gambling on platforms with non-UK licenses.

Potential Drawbacks

1. **Lack of Regulatory Protection**: One of the major downsides of playing at non-UK licensed casinos is the absence of protection that comes from UK licenses. This can increase risks such as unfair gaming practices, difficulty in resolving disputes, and delayed payments.

2. **Withdrawal Issues**: Players might face challenges when it comes to processing withdrawals. Non-UK licensed casinos may not have robust payment systems in place, leading to potential delays or complications when cashing out winnings.

3. **Limited Legal Recourse**: If players encounter issues with non-UK casinos, pursuing complaints or seeking legal recourse can be more challenging. The jurisdiction governing the casino might not be as accessible, and players may have limited options for resolution.

4. **Potential Scams**: While not all non-UK licensed casinos are fraudulent, there can be a higher risk of encountering scams or untrustworthy platforms. Due diligence is essential when choosing a casino to ensure it is reputable and offers fair gaming conditions.

How to Choose a Safe Non-UK Licensed Casino

When exploring non-UK licensed casinos, it is imperative that players conduct thorough research to ensure a safe playing experience. Here are some tips for selecting a trustworthy platform:

1. **Check the License**: Always check what regulatory authority has issued the casino’s license. Licensing from reputable jurisdictions like Malta or Gibraltar generally indicates a level of trustworthiness.

2. **Read Reviews**: Look for player reviews and feedback online. Websites dedicated to casino reviews can provide insights into the experiences of others and highlight any potential issues.

3. **Evaluate Game Providers**: Reputable non-UK licensed casinos typically partner with well-known software providers. Look for names like NetEnt, Microgaming, or Evolution Gaming to ensure quality games.

4. **Assess Payment Options**: A wide range of payment methods that include secure options such as e-wallets or cryptocurrencies can indicate a reliable casino. Check for transaction fees and withdrawal times.

5. **Test Customer Support**: Reach out to customer service before signing up to evaluate the responsiveness and helpfulness of the support team. This can be a good indicator of the level of service players can expect.
